Probably one of the best training days so far
4 January 2013
The year started great so far and after a marathon session at Fight capital with my Jiu Jitsu coach David Howard i finished the day at Sunset Boxing with my striking coach Robert Navone.
We started with a lot of Yoga in the morning, continued with some Wrestling/Judo throws and worked at some submissions.
The morning workout ended with an immense ammount of mat time rolling with 9 other fighters of the team.
After about 2 hours of rest the second training was focused on striking and some more rounds of mat time on the ground.
